Dollar recoups some losses as focus shifts to Fed remarks at Jackson Hole
The U.S. dollar has shown signs of recovering some of its previous week's losses as investors anticipate signals on the Federal Reserve's policy direction at the Jackson Hole symposium. This follows recent data indicating that inflation remained stickier than economists had expected.
